Deutsche Bank

QA & Automation lead - Senior Engineer

Pune, India
Go Microservices API Git Java JavaScript AWS Azure C#
Description

Job Description:

Job Title - Automation Engineer

Location - Pune

Role Description

QA & Test automation engineer with good experience automating UI & API testing who must ensure, by testing and automating all the quality checks needed to be performed to ensure the right quality of the system developed.

What we’ll offer you

As part of our flexible scheme, here are just some of the benefits that you’ll enjoy

  • Best in class leave policy
  • Gender neutral parental leaves
  • 100% reimbursement under childcare assistance benefit (gender neutral)
  • Sponsorship for Industry relevant certifications and education
  • Employee Assistance Program for you and your family members
  • Comprehensive Hospitalization Insurance for you and your dependents
  • Accident and Term life Insurance
  • Complementary Health screening for 35 yrs. and above

Your key responsibilities

  • Develop test automation strategy for large complex projects in AGILE methodology.
  • Develop non-functional testing automation strategy for large complex projects in AGILE methodology.
  • Contribute to team agile planning activities and backlog prioritization and management.
  • Collaborates with product line stakeholders to understand and develop strategies, frameworks relating to their emerging demands.
  • Driving innovation/adoption of Industry practices through investigation/institutionalization of new tools/methods/standards.
  • Ensures that testing activities are being conducted in accordance with the testing strategy and plan.
  • Perform and achieve in sprint testing team and release goals.
  • Create test documents like: Test Plan, Test Risk Assessments, and Test Results and make sure that they are reviewed and approved by appropriate stakeholders.
  • Participate in estimation of User Stories in Story points.
  • Create, Automate and Execute test cases to cover all user stories acceptance criteria and honor timely deliveries.
  • Increase the test coverage and test speed by automating all possible test cases.
  • Create and develop test automation frameworks.
  • Integrate test automation framework into CI/CD pipeline.
  • Ensure test flakiness is at a minimum.
  • Participate and help in knowledge transfer sessions when necessary.
  • Defect’s submission, monitoring, and retesting
  • Keep demo sessions to prove acceptance criteria are met.
  • Coordinate the preparation of test environments.
  • Define and create all test data / test data generators needed for the tests.
  • Maintain regression test pack.
  • Align with dev team to understand the integration with different systems to execute System Integration Testing
  • Provide regular status reporting to scrum team.
  • Verify entry/exit criteria for all SIT, UAT, PPD, PROD phases.

Your skills and experience

Mandatory:

  • Experience in Test automation using any of available tools (JMeter, Cypress, RestAssured, Karate, Postman etc.)
  • Experience in using/following - GIT, confluence, test case management, test strategies and execution plan.
  • Experience in agile QA processes, In-Sprint testing, and signoffs.
  • Good verbal and written communication skills.

Nice to have:

  • Experience with modern SDLC tools - Git, JIRA, Artifactory, Jenkins/TeamCity is a plus.
  • Experience working in any one of cloud providers i.e., AWS, Azure, or Google.
  • Experience in coding test automation flows with any of the available programming languages i.e., Java/C#/JavaScript/GO.
  • Understanding of microservices architecture, integration of different services etc.

Experience:

  • Bachelor’s degree in computer science or related technical field or equivalent practical experience.
  • 10+ years of professional software testing and automation experience.
  • Experience in end-to-end testing right from understanding the requirement/stories to QA sign-off.
  • Experience in REST API testing, Functional Ui test automation, Integration Testing.
  • Experience in working with tools such as JMeter, Karate, Playwright, Selenium, and API frameworks.
  • Experience implementing BDD & TDD approach.
  • Knowledge of test coverage and different testing metrices.
  • Good Java programming and object-oriented concepts and coding skills.

How we’ll support you

  • Training and development to help you excel in your career
  • Coaching and support from experts in your team
  • A culture of continuous learning to aid progression
  • A range of flexible benefits that you can tailor to suit your needs

About us and our teams

Please visit our company website for further information:

https://www.db.com/company/company.htm

We strive for a culture in which we are empowered to excel together every day. This includes acting responsibly, thinking commercially, taking initiative and working collaboratively.

Together we share and celebrate the successes of our people. Together we are Deutsche Bank Group.

We welcome applications from all people and promote a positive, fair and inclusive work environment.

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say